hi....lots of 'firsts' here again for me.....the sheaths shade of brown is bit darker in reality, sun has brightened it...4mm shoulder....all dyes mixed from 5 basic fiebings colours....the inside of the sheath is lined with 1mm black leather and stitched and glued in place to protect stitching, the liner also forms part of the welt so the sheaths coming in at nearly 1.5cm thick as the lining adds to it....bit of a beast....fiebings finish, carnauba and edgekote (in pictures it hasnt yet been edgekoted....done now tho)....colours hand-painted on with brush....embossing stamp courtesy of kerne....(steve....mountainm...luckylee....hillbill....i better be gettin some thumb sympathy now....the nails fallen off and i have partial paralysis in my left arm lol!)

hope you like! criticism wanted as always please!
